description
NPL requires a combined Potentiostat/Galvanostat/Frequency Response Analyser system for battery testing with at least 5 channels each having electrochemical impedance spectroscopy (EIS) capability incorporated, i.e. not multiplexed. The system shall be able to test batteries at currents ≥ 100 A and voltages ≥ 50 V, either directly via the system channels or in conjunction with internal or external boosters, to allow fast charge/discharge rates and to study large cells, modules and packs. It is additionally required that the channels can also perform low current and voltage measurements with a minimum current ≤ 0.1 mA.
We require the ability to characterise performance and lifetime of batteries using such a test system. The test facility will be capable of accurately measuring charge and discharge curves, cycle capacity, state of charge and state of health (via EIS) not only for Li-ion batteries but also other emerging battery chemistries. As a National Measurement Institute, measurement resolution and system performance are a very high priority. A low footprint for expansion of number of channels, the ability to save data in internal memory during long term tests and software for battery analysis are also desirable.
